Study On Screening Methods And Threatening Pressure Of Maize Varieties To Low Nitrogen Tolerance

In this paper, screening methods and threatening pressure of maize varietyes were studied under low nitrogen levels using solution incubation pot experiment. Here the main results of this study are presented:1.According to critical period definition of plant nutrition, aftering three leaves stage, four leaves stage of maize genotype is likely to critical period of screening maize genotypes for resisting to low nitrogen levels.2. Under very low nitrogen level of 0. 05mol/L , there were significant differences in N-deficiency ,shoot dry weight .ratio of root weight to shoot weight and total nitrogen uptake among different maize genotypes ,with readily assessed low nitrogen nutrition characters of maize genotypes. So, nitrogen level of 0. 05mol/L is probably proper threatening pressure for screening low nitrogen maize genotypes.3. There were to some extent influence of different stage supplying nitrogen on N-deficiency, biological biomass, morphological characteristics and plant nitrogen nutrition status of different maize genotypes. Amang above some indices, biological biomadd .root bulk, totalnitrogen uptake and N-deficiency appeared notably variation, which abviously reflected stage characteristics of nitrogen nutrition of maize varieties.4. Xinghai201, Xinghuangdan892, Guibi303, jiaosandanjiao, yayu No.2 and Qianxing No. 4 has high capacity to uptake nitrogen under low nitrogen threatening situation, and existing higher nitrogen utilization efficiency.
